Output ee5610d17094b37ce0495ee8b1b1421ea5cc39d0e5d58eb89f6bde7abaed237f:0

value
58542899
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e489574901c43f166d32fbfd61d12ce22cb3e7a6 OP_EQUAL
address
MUjYpnTWySUpx9ZgPeRHRcVpsdnX8Y2Bg7
transaction
ee5610d17094b37ce0495ee8b1b1421ea5cc39d0e5d58eb89f6bde7abaed237f
spent
true